Trevor Nunn to Direct ROSENCRANTZ AND GUILDENSTERN ARE DEAD at TRHC
by Nicole Rosky - Apr 1, 2011


Following the opening of Terence Rattigan's Flare Path, the Theatre Royal Haymarket Company today (1 April 2011) announce a further two productions to be directed by Trevor Nunn in his role as Artistic Director. After a three week run at the Chichester Festival Theatre, Nunn's production of Tom Stoppard's Rosencrantz and Guildenstern Are Dead comes to the Theatre Royal Haymarket in June, followed in September by William Shakespeare's The Tempest. Further productions in the season will be announced shortly.

Natalie Casey Joins West End's LEGALLY BLONDE as Paulette
by Nicole Rosky - Mar 22, 2011


From 26 April 2011 Natalie Casey will join the west end cast of the Olivier award-wining Legally Blonde The Musical to play ditzy beautician Paulette Buonofonté. She joins Susan McFadden as Elle Woods, Carley Stenson as Margot, Nicola Brazil as Serena, Siobhan Dillon as Vivienne and Peter Davison as Professor Callahan. Natalie Casey takes over the role from Denise Van Outen, whose last performance will be Saturday 23 April. From mid-June Lee Mead will join the west end cast to play Emmett Forrest.

Photo Flash: Miller. Purefoy, et al. in FLARE PATH
by Nicole Rosky - Mar 9, 2011


Sienna Miller, James Purefoy and Sheridan Smith lead the cast in Terence Rattigan's Flare Path at the Theatre Royal Haymarket, directed by Trevor Nunn. Set and costumes are by Stephen Brimson Lewis with light by Paul Pyant, sound by Paul Groothuis and projection design by Jack James. Flare Path is produced by Matthew Byam Shaw for Playful Productions, Theatre Royal Haymarket Company, Act Productions Ltd and Tom McKitterick.
